WIC is a supplemental food program and isn't meant to provide all the formula or foods your child may need. During your pregnancy, breastfeeding is encouraged but if you plan on using formula, it is recommended that you purchase some formula to last until we are able to add your child to the WIC program.

When you arrive for your appointment be sure to come on time with all needed paperwork filled out and bring all proofs as required.If the appointment is for a child, be sure to bring the child with you.
If you are being added to the WIC program or if you have a reassessment or recertification appointment for your child, you should have been given forms to be filled out and brought back for your appointment.If you have misplaced the forms please stop by our office or call and we can mail you the forms.Having the forms completed will help make your WIC appointment go much faster.
Did you know you can do your WIC Nutrition Education Classes Online?
Go to the following website -WIC Families - Education Components and follow the simple instructions for completing the class. You will be asked to print and bring the certificate to your next WIC appointment. If you do not bring the certificate you will not receive credit for completing the WIC class and will need to attend the nutrition education class at the Health Center.
